What the phrase refers to
- v402r11 — Likely a firmware version identifier used by a device vendor. Version strings vary by manufacturer; this one suggests a specific release (major 4, minor 02, revision 11).
- H.264 / H.265 — Video compression standards (also called AVC and HEVC). Firmware for DVRs (Digital Video Recorders) and NVRs (Network Video Recorders) frequently includes support, optimizations, or licensing for these codecs to encode, decode, and record camera streams efficiently.
- DVR / NVR — Devices used for recording surveillance video. DVRs generally work with analog camera inputs; NVRs handle IP/network cameras.
- Firmware download / high quality — The user intent: obtain a firmware file that upgrades a device, possibly to add H.265 support, improve recording quality, fix bugs, or enhance performance.

Risks and concerns
- Malicious or tampered firmware: Downloading from unofficial or untrusted sources can introduce backdoors, malware, or remote access vulnerabilities.
- Device incompatibility: Installing firmware not designed for the exact model or hardware revision can brick the device.
- Licensing/legal issues: H.265 encoders/decoders may require licensing; unofficial firmware might bypass licensing or infringe terms.
- Loss of settings or data: Firmware upgrades often reset settings or erase recordings if not handled correctly.
- Privacy/security regressions: New firmware can unintentionally weaken security (e.g., default credentials, open services).
How to evaluate authenticity and quality
- Prefer downloads from the device manufacturer’s official website or verified distributors.
- Check firmware release notes and changelogs for concrete fixes and features rather than vague “improvements.”
- Verify checksums or digital signatures when provided to ensure integrity.
- Confirm the firmware filename, version string (e.g., v402r11), and supported hardware models match your device’s exact model and hardware/PCB revision.
- Look for community feedback: user forums, reputable tech sites, or official support threads reporting successful installs.
- Avoid sites promising “universal” firmware or labeled only with SEO keywords (e.g., “high quality download”) without vendor attribution.
Safe download and installation steps
- Identify the exact model number and hardware revision of your DVR/NVR (from device label, web UI, or printed manual).
- Check the manufacturer’s support/download page for the listed version (v402r11 or later).
- Read the release notes for v402r11: what changed, known issues, prerequisites, and rollback procedure.
- Download only from the official vendor site or authorized partner. If using a mirror, verify checksum/signature.
- Backup current configuration and any critical recordings. Export settings if the device supports it.
- Follow the vendor’s installation instructions: use the correct web UI or upgrade tool, and avoid power interruption during the flash.
- After upgrade, verify device operation: camera streams, recording, network access, NTP, users, and security settings. Restore configuration if needed.
- If problems occur, consult vendor support or community threads; restore a backup or reflash an official prior version if available.

The V4.02.R11 firmware is a common system version for "white label" or generic Chinese DVRs and NVRs, often associated with the manufacturer Xiong Mai (XM). It supports both H.264 and H.265 compression standards and is typically used in devices powered by HiSilicon System-on-Chip (SoC) hardware. Finding the Correct Firmware Version
Because "V4.02.R11" is a generic version string, downloading the wrong file can brick your device. You must identify your specific System Version ID:
Navigate to Version Info: Log into your DVR/NVR and go to [System Info] > [Version].
Locate the 8-digit ID: Look for a string like V4.02.R11.XXXXXXXX. The 8 digits (e.g., 00031095) are unique to your hardware platform.
Vendor Code: The first three digits (e.g., 000) usually indicate the vendor (General).
Platform Version: The last three digits (e.g., 095) represent the specific motherboard platform. Download Sources
